Nike Air Jordan 4 Retro 'Imperial Purple' Sneakers Release Details Nike is set to reintroduce the Air Jordan 4 sneakers, originally launched in 1989, in a new “Imperial Purple” colorway for a new generation. The sneakers are scheduled to release on Saturday, March 7 at 10 a.m. ET/7 a.m. PT. Priced at $220, the design features a combination of authentic and synthetic leather, along with a luxurious nubuck upper that offers a retro aesthetic with a modern twist. The colorway includes imperial purple, dark yellow, dark charcoal, and dark grayish cyan, making it ideal for casual wear. The sneakers retain iconic design elements, such as the “Jumpman” logo on the tongue, head-turning netting, the “Nike Air” logo on each heel, a transparent air bubble in the midsole, and metallic silver wings on the collar. These details highlight the shoe’s enduring appeal, blending its original 1989 design with contemporary styling. The release marks another milestone in Nike’s ongoing collaboration with Michael Jordan, whose signature sneakers have become a cultural phenomenon since their debut. The Air Jordan 4 "Lakers" Take Flight This Weekend The Air Jordan 4 "Lakers" colorway is set to release this Saturday, March 7, and will be available for purchase at 10:00 a.m. EST. The retro basketball sneakers, inspired by the Los Angeles Lakers, will be sold through Nike SNKRS, Foot Locker, Champs Sports, and Hibbett stores. The shoes will be offered in a full-size range, including adult, big kid, little kid, and toddler sizes, priced at $220, $165, $105, and $90 respectively. Fans who miss the initial drop can find the sneakers on resale platforms like StockX and GOAT, where the average resale price currently stands at $293, with some listings reaching up to $300. The "Lakers" colorway is officially labeled as the "Imperial Purple" edition, a name that reflects the Lakers' storied history. The design features a deep purple upper made of premium nubuck, accented with University Gold at the outsole. The Air units in the midsole tie the look together, while the "Nike Air" branding on the heels includes a speckled design to mimic an aged appearance. The outsole also incorporates the Lakers' iconic purple and gold colors, creating a cohesive and striking aesthetic. The release of the Air Jordan 4 "Lakers" colorway coincides with a historical reference to Michael Jordan's 1991 NBA Finals matchup against the Lakers. At the time, Jordan's Chicago Bulls ended the Lakers' dynasty, preventing them from securing another championship for the rest of the decade. While Jordan never wore purple and gold on the court due to NBA rules and his competitive nature, the colorway pays homage to the Lakers' legacy by blending their signature colors into the design.
